Barbados PM moves to quell rumours that he’s gravely ill...



BRIDGETOWN, Barbados – Prime Minister David Thompson is seeking to quell rumours that he is gravely ill two weeks after he told the nation he was unwell and would be absent from duty for an unspecified period of time.

As the rumours intensified yesterday, Thompson issued a statement from his New York apartment where he and his wife, Mara, have been waiting out his period of medical observations…

Two members of the "Grenada 17" return to prison, as employees....

ST GEORGE’S, Grenada – Two members of the “Grenada 17” are back at the Richmond Hill Prison, this time as civil servants, documents presented in Parliament show.

Former army chief General Hudson Austin has landed a job as building supervisor while Leon “Bogo” Cornwall has been hired to work with the prison’s education programme.

Both Austin and Cornwall were among the last batch of prisoners…

Death toll reaches 44 in Kingston...

THE number of civilians confirmed killed in the security force operation in West Kingston has reached 44.

Political Ombudsman Herro Blair, speaking on RJR 94 FM, said that he had counted 35 at the morgue with another nine bodies awaiting collection.

Meantime Public Defender Earl Witter is questioning the disparity between numbers killed and the number of firearms seized. Security forces have so far…
